Iryna Korshunova is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Iryna Korshunova has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 553 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 2 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 2 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Iryna Korshunova's work include Epilepsy research and treatment (2 papers), E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(2 papers) and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(2 papers). Iryna Korshunova is often cited by papers focused on Epilepsy research and treatment (2 papers), E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(2 papers) and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(2 papers). Iryna Korshunova coll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, United States and Australia. Iryna Korshunova's co-authors include Joni Dambre, Lucas Theis, Wenzhe Shi, Benjamin H. Brinkmann, Simone C. Bosshard, Francisco Javier Muñoz–Almaraz, Charles H. Vite, Edward E. Patterson, Juan Pardo and Gregory A. Worrell and has published in prestigious journals such as Brain, IEEE Transactions on Biomedical Engineering and arXiv (Cornell University).

All Works

7 of 7 papers shown
1.
Korshunova, Iryna, et al.. (2019). Discriminative Topic Modeling with Logistic LDA. arXiv (Cornell University). 32. 1–11. 5 indexed citations
2.
Korshunova, Iryna, Jonas Degrave, Ferenc Huszár, et al.. (2018). BRUNO: A Deep Recurrent Model for Exchangeable Data. arXiv (Cornell University). 31. 7190–7198. 5 indexed citations
3.
Korshunova, Iryna, Wenzhe Shi, Joni Dambre, & Lucas Theis. (2017). Fast Face-Swap Using Convolutional Neural Networks. 3697–3705. 311 indexed citations
4.
Korshunova, Iryna, et al.. (2017). Towards Improved Design and Evaluation of Epileptic Seizure Predictors. IEEE Transactions on Biomedical Engineering. 65(3). 502–510. 32 indexed citations
5.
Degrave, Jonas, et al.. (2016). Using deep learning to estimate systolic and diastolic volumes from MRI-images. Ghent University Academic Bibliography (Ghent University). 1 indexed citations
6.
Brinkmann, Benjamin H., Joost Wagenaar, Simone C. Bosshard, et al.. (2016). Crowdsourcing reproducible seizure forecasting in human and canine epilepsy. Brain. 139(6). 1713–1722. 190 indexed citations
7.
Sturm, Bob L., João Felipe Santos, & Iryna Korshunova. (2015). Folk music style modelling by recurrent neural networks with long short term memory units. Ghent University Academic Bibliography (Ghent University). 9 indexed citations
